Easy Freezer-Friendly Patriotic Ice Cream Sandwiches

These festive, no-bake ice cream sandwiches are quick to make, freezer-friendly, and perfect for summer celebrations like the Fourth of July. They combine creamy vanilla ice cream, chewy cookies, and patriotic toppings for a crowd-pleasing dessert.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 quart (4 cups) vanilla ice cream, softened slightly
  • 24 sandwich cookies (chocolate chip, sugar cookies, or soft chocolate wafers)
  • 1 cup fresh strawberries, sliced thinly
  • 1 cup fresh blueberries, whole
  • 1/4 cup red sprinkles (optional)
  • 1/4 cup blue sprinkles (optional)
  • 1/2 cup mini marshmallows (optional)
  • Non-stick cooking spray or parchment paper for lining trays

Instructions

  1. Let the vanilla ice cream sit at room temperature for about 5-10 minutes until scoopable but not melted.
  2.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per or a silicone mat for easy freezing and transfer.
  3. Lay out half of the cookies flat-side up on the baking sheet (12 cookies for 12 sandwiches).
  4. Using a spatula or butter knife, scoop about 2 tablespoons (30 ml) of softened ice cream onto each cookie and spread gently to the edges without overfilling.
  5. Sprinkle sliced strawberries, blueberries, red and blue sprinkles, and mini marshmallows evenly over the ice cream layer.
  6. Press the remaining cookies flat-side down gently but firmly on top of the ice cream and toppings.
  7. Place the baking sheet in the freezer for at least 2 hours, or until sandwiches are firm and ice cream is solid.
  8. Once frozen, transfer the sandwiches to a freezer-safe container or zip-top bags, layering parchment paper between sandwiches to prevent sticking.

Notes

Use softer cookies to avoid cracking during assembly. If ice cream is too hard to spread, let it soften a bit longer; if too soft, chill briefly in the freezer. Freeze sandwiches on a tray before storing to keep shape intact. Layer parchment paper between sandwiches to prevent sticking. Can substitute dairy-free ice cream and gluten-free cookies for dietary needs.
